Complete this online quiz  and then complete a mini analysis to be posted to the “A Lesson Before Dying” page of your Weebly.com:

  • title and author
  • protagonist
  • major characters (excluding protagonist)
  • point of view (be specific 1st, 3rd omniscient, or 3rd limited)
  • setting (time and place)
  • tone (two or three adjectives)
  • irony (2 examples, with brief explanation)
  • symbols (2 repeated objects or motifs, with brief explanation)
  • theme (write a specific sentence about an issue or idea) explanation of title
